Nestled in northwest London, Harlesden train station is a vibrant gateway to both local neighbourhoods and bustling city life. As an integral part of the London Overground, Harlesden offers a convenient starting point for your journey, whether you are commuting to work, heading to the heart of the city for some sightseeing, or exploring the diverse boroughs of Greater London. While modest in its offerings, the station still caters to the essentials and connects travellers with the city's extensive public transportation network.
Harlesden station doesn't boast a ticket office, but fret not, as there are ticket machines available to purchase and collect the tickets you've booked online. These machines are user-friendly and accessible for those who need tickets for the London Underground, offering Travelcards for daily or weekly use. Staff assistance is available, with customer help points across the station ready to provide any information or support you might need. Keep in mind, however, that the station does not offer step-free access, so it may not be suitable for those with mobility impairments.
Despite the absence of several amenities such as waiting rooms, toilets, and a refreshment area, Harlesden is equipped with CCTV to ensure passenger safety. The station doesn't have smartcard validators, but considering London’s transport, you won't have trouble with Oyster cards or contactless payments on your journey. While there aren't facilities for luggage storage, Harlesden promotes a practical approach to city travel.

Bolton train station is well-equipped to cater to any traveler's needs. With a ticket office operating from 06:00 to 21:00 on weekdays and slightly reduced hours on Sundays, obtaining and collecting tickets is straightforward. Numerous ticket machines are available for those who prefer a swift, automated service, and these cater to both cash and card transactions. The station champions accessibility, ensuring step-free access throughout the premises, including lifts to all platforms, which makes it a Category A station.
For those needing assistance, Bolton station offers staff-support options, although customer help points are absent. Amenities at the station include clean, accessible toilets, baby changing facilities, and cozy waiting rooms—between platforms for your comfort while awaiting departure. CCTV ensures a safe environment as you explore the variety of refreshment facilities and the newsagent available on-site.
Getting from Bolton Station to your onward destination is as easy as pie. Newport Street is home to a coordinated rail replacement service, while a robust bus network connects you to bustling locales throughout Greater Manchester. The bus services are supported by printable information available here to aid in planning. Bicycle enthusiasts will be thrilled to hear of the bicycle hire options detailed at cycling.tfgm.com, offering a green alternative for exploring the local area.
